## Changelog — dedupe service 1.7

Rotated the signing key for the Marrowlane dedupe pipeline as part of this release. The customer-record deduplication job now signs merged-record manifests before writing to the canonical store, preventing replay of stale merges. Old key is revoked effective this build. For the weekly eng sync record, the new signing key is below.

rollout seal: bky9_PeXH1fTLY

Action item from the Mirewater tide-table widget incident. Owner: release manager. Widget cached stale harbor offsets after the DST change, showing tides six hours off for two days. Required: add a cache-invalidation check to the release checklist, block deploys when offset tables are older than 24 hours, and verify the Saltgate harbor feed before each cut. Deadline: next release. Checklist template and sign-off procedure are documented on the internal page below.

wiki page, kawif-bajep: https://artifactory.zarqelforge.internal/issue/browse/display/display/projects/spaces/secrets/000fe6ec5a46af29355003e1

**Q: Why does PortionPal sometimes round ingredient amounts weirdly when scaling down?**

A: Short answer: the rounding rules are unit-aware, so teaspoons round differently than grams. It trips up everyone at first. If a customer reports odd numbers, it's usually expected behavior, not a bug. The full rounding table and examples live on the internal page below.

dashboard of yajep-taguf = https://gitlab.norvastack.test/ticket

Subject: Licensing dispute — Ferrowell codec suite

Executive team and heads of department,

Ferrowell Systems has formally contested our use of the Cadenza codec in the Mirelle product line. Counsel advises our licence likely covers the disputed module, but litigation risk is nontrivial. We are documenting usage history and preparing alternatives. Our contingency position on this matter appears below.

— Dorian Vesk

board note of bawep-tajef: Queniusek Systems plans to raise the Quenvan list price by 53.1 percent in March. The pricing group signed off on a budget of $176.4 million for Project Drueth. The renewal with Casionix Partners closes at $142.5 million a year, 8.3 percent below the last contract. Project Fraax slips by six weeks because of the tooling delay.